Profile Wei Li

Dr. Wei Li is a Professor at National Research Center of Pumps, Jiangsu University, China. He obtained his BE in 2003, ME in 2005 and PhD in Engineering in Fluid Machinery from Jiangsu University in 2012, and worked there since 2006. He was a visiting scholar in professor Ramesh Agarwal’s group at Department of Mechanical Engineering & Materials Science, Washington University in St. Louis from 2017-2018. He is currently the deputy director of National Research Center of Pumps of China, and the director of the Key Laboratory in Energy Saving Technology of Pump and System of China Petroleum and Chemical Industry. 2016 he served as Vice-Secretary of Drainage and Irrigation Equipment Division of Chinese Society for Agricultural Machinery, 2019 he served as Secretary-General of Power Engineering and Engineering Thermophysics Discipline Union of Universities in Jiangsu Province, 2020 he served as vice-President of China National Evaluation Measurement Test Alliance of Flow Meter. His research interest is focused on designing and optimization of advanced devices for high-efficiency pumped storage and hydropower utilization, particularly of energy loss mechanism in mixed-flow pump. He has published more than 150 papers, hold 35 patents and wrote 1 technical books and participated 2 books in the compilation and translation. His work has been recognized by several awards including the National Science and Technology Award (Second Class) of China, the National Teaching Achievement Award (Second Class) of China, the Industry-University-Research Cooperation innovation Achievement Award (First Class) of China, the Science and Technology Award (Second Class) of Chinese ministry of education, the Science and Technology Award (Third Class) of Jiangsu Province (China) and the Silver award of the first China Dual-use Technology Innovation and Application Competition.
